Factors to Consider When Choosing Zico Ladder Rack Parts

When you pick Zico ladder rack parts, make sure they match your ladder’s model and material so they fit securely. Check the load‑capacity limits and corrosion‑resistant features to guarantee safety and longevity. Finally, choose components that install quickly and easily, saving you time and hassle.

Compatibility Material Materials

Choosing the right Zico ladder rack parts starts with ensuring they match your rack’s exact model and dimensions, because a poor fit can compromise safety and performance. You’ll need to verify the mounting points, bolt patterns, and overall length before you buy. Next, examine the material: aluminum offers lightness and rust resistance, while steel adds heft and ruggedness. Aircraft‑grade aluminum delivers premium strength without excess weight, making it ideal for frequent off‑road trips. Look for powder‑coated or galvanized finishes, which guard against UV exposure, rain, and road salt, extending the parts’ life and keeping them looking sharp. Finally, match the material to your climate and usage—lightweight aluminum for dry, coastal areas, or steel for harsh, snowy conditions.

Load Capacity Limits

Understanding load capacity limits is essential before you bolt on any Zico ladder rack parts, because exceeding those limits can cause structural failure. You need to check each component’s weight rating and the total system capacity. Materials, design, and intended use all affect how much weight the rack can safely support. Aluminum brackets may handle less load than steel ones, and a rack designed for occasional camping trips won’t hold the same weight as a model built for heavy‑duty hauling. Always match the parts to your specific application and never exceed the manufacturer’s recommended limits. By respecting these ratings, you keep the rack stable, protect your gear, and avoid costly accidents on the trail.

Corrosion Resistance Features

Since ladder racks spend most of their time outdoors, you’ll want parts that can stand up to rain, salt, and humidity without rusting. Choose components with galvanized or powder‑coated finishes; they create a barrier that repels moisture and slow corrosion. Opt for stainless steel hardware when you need extra durability—its alloy composition resists rust better than standard steel, especially in coastal or high‑moisture settings. Aluminum parts are lightweight and naturally corrosion‑resistant, and an anodized coating adds another protective layer, extending service life. Regularly inspect bolts, brackets, and clamps for signs of wear or pitting, and replace any compromised pieces promptly. This proactive upkeep keeps your rack sturdy, safe, and ready for every adventure.
